Abstract

PURPOSE: To adapt a single tool body to the whole tool heads by joining a reduction gear installed on a separating tool head to an electric motor of a main body. CONSTITUTION: A tool head 2 contains a reduction gear 20 and a blind hole 21. This reduction gear 20 is symmetrical with a driving gear 14 of a main body 1 to be driven by the driving gear 14. The blind hole 21 is formed to insert the extending end 13 of a safety switch 11. Next, when either of this tool head 2 is joined to the main body 1, the extending end 13 of the safety switch 11 is inserted into the blind hole 21. In this, the driving gear 14 performs machining by driving the tool head 2 when an electric motor 10 is rotated when a circuit is close after mutually connecting the connecting part 110 and the connecting part 111.

(Prior Art) Electric tools are widely used because they are convenient. However, in the conventional type, the electric motor and speed reducer are all installed inside the main body, so it is only compatible with one type of tool and not another. For example, a cordless screwdriver is not compatible with a drill head because the screwdriver's unique rotational speed does not match the rotational speed requirements of a drill.

(Implementation Arrangement) Referring to the drawings, especially FIG. 2, the main body 1 of the multifunctional electric tool according to the present invention includes an electric motor 10, a safety switch 11, and a drive gear 14. An electric motor 10 is attached to the main body 1 and drives a drive gear 14. The safety switch 11 is a press-type switch attached to the main body 1. The switch has an elongated end 13 extending from the body 1 (FIG. 6A), with one end connected to a spring 12 (FIG. 6A).

The tool head 2 in FIG. 3 includes a reduction gear 20 and a blind hole 21. The tool head 2 in FIG. The reduction gear 20 is symmetrical to the drive gear 14 of the main body 1 and is driven by the drive gear 14 . The blind hole 21 is for insertion of the extended end 13 of the safety switch 11. 6A and 6B) when any of the tool heads 2 shown in FIG.
is inserted into the blind hole 21. This means that when the connection part 110 and the connection part 111 are connected to each other, the circuit is closed and the electric motor 10 is rotated, the drive gear 14 drives the tool head for machining. Safety switch 1
1 is not inserted into the blind hole 21, the connection part 110 and the connection part 111 remain separated forever, the circuit is open, and the motor 10 cannot therefore rotate and the tool Head 2 is not driven.

The tool head 2 shown in FIG. 1 has many different types, each type of tool head having its own rotational speed ratio. The reduction gear 20 attached to each tool head 2 (Figs. 3.6A and 6B) is subject to the requirements on the rotational speed ratio, so that even if the rotational speed ratio of the electric motor is Gear 20 always changes ratio to itself. In this way, one electric tool of the invention can be adapted to all tool heads regardless of speed ratio.
